Butter Rolls
Butter Rolls is an easy dinner. Made with 2 sticks pure butter, melted, 2 c. flour, 1 c. sugar, 1 tsp. nutmeg and 2 (5 count) cans biscuits,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. A classic recipe that has been enjoyed for generations.

Melt butter in a pan.
In another bowl, put flour, sugar and nutmeg.
Mix dry ingredients.
Cut each biscuit into halves.
Dip in butter, then in flour mixture.
Place and layer in baking pan. Sprinkle rest of leftover flour mixture over biscuits and pour leftover butter on top.
Boil enough water to pour over all to about 3/4 inch of top of pan.
Bake at 325Β° until brown and done.
